The Arizona desert offers no mercy to a man with a wounded heart. Lieutenant Gerald Blake came to this sun-scorched outpost seeking distance from a betrayal that left him cynical and hollow. Instead, he finds a world where trust is currency and every handshake hides a knife. Captain Nevins, his fellow officer, is a man whose dishonest dealings weave a web that entraps soldiers, settlers, and secrets alike. As the stagecoach rolls in with new arrivals who will complicate every life it touches, Blake must navigate not just the harsh frontier but his own bitter assumptions about loyalty, love, and what it means to be a man of honor in a land without law. Sancho and Pedro add color to this dusty world, but the real terrain is psychological: a man learning that you cannot outrun your wounds, only confront them.
